A high-contrast serif with pronounced vertical stress, thick main stems, and very fine hairlines. Serifs are sharp and delicate with minimal bracketing, giving the outlines a crisp, cut-paper feel in large sizes. Capitals are stately and fairly wide with strong triangular and wedge-like transitions in letters such as N, V, W, and Y, while round forms like C, G, and O show a tight, controlled modulation. Lowercase forms are compact and tidy with a two-storey a and g, a narrow, lightly curving r, and a tall, slender t with a small crossbar; the overall rhythm is refined and slightly dramatic. Numerals echo the same contrast and verticality, with elegant curves and thin connecting strokes that read best when not too small.

This typeface is well suited to headlines, pull quotes, magazine titling, and premium branding where high contrast can be showcased. It also works for invitations, product packaging, and poster typography that benefits from a sophisticated, high-impact serif. For longer passages, it will perform best with comfortable sizes and spacing so the hairlines and tight apertures remain clear.

The font conveys a polished, upscale tone associated with luxury publishing and contemporary classicism. Its sharp hairlines and sculpted curves feel poised and deliberate, projecting sophistication and authority rather than warmth. The overall impression is dramatic but controlled—ideal for designs that need elegance with a strong editorial voice.

The design appears intended to reinterpret classic high-contrast serif conventions with a clean, modern sharpness. By emphasizing vertical stress, fine serifs, and sculpted curves, it aims to deliver an elevated editorial look that feels timeless yet contemporary in display applications.

At display sizes the hairlines and fine serifs create striking sparkle and crisp texture, while at smaller sizes those details may require generous rendering conditions to avoid losing definition. The design’s narrow internal joins and thin cross-strokes create a refined, high-fashion color on the page, especially in mixed-case settings.
